The Department of Strategic Communications and Marketing is excited to announce the launch of the Division of Academic & Student Affairs news blog, our new forum for promoting divisional updates and achievements!  

As with all news published by FIU, we aim to highlight content on DASA News that elevates the university, showcases student success, and promotes the accomplishments of our Division. Content categories include Student Success, Campus and Community, Career Development, Student Clubs and Organizations, Parents and Families, and Staff News. The website will also feature a calendar feed to display upcoming events.
